Developers secure $73.3 million loan for student housing project

AECOM-Canyon Partners, in a joint venture with Martin Group, announced the closing of a $73.3 million senior construction loan from Pacific Western Bank to begin the transit-oriented development of Wexler on 65th, a mid-rise student housing project near California State University, Sacramento.

Construction is scheduled to commence in June 2020 and is set to reach completion by Fall 2022.

The 223-unit project will offer a mix of studio, two-, three-, four-, and five-bedroom units, featuring bedroom-bathroom parity, in addition to numerous tenant amenities, ample parking, and approximately 7,400 sq. ft. of commercial space.

The property is located less than a 5-minute walk from the university’s Hornet Crossing entrance and adjacent to several retail and dining options. It is directly adjacent to Sacramento Regional Transit Authority’s University/65th St. Gold Line light rail station.

With a total enrolment of over 31,000, Sacramento State is the sixth largest university in the California State University system..
